CITY OF CARLSBAD
PUBLIC WORKS LETTER OF AGREEMENT
TREE REMOVAL IN SUNNYCREEK
CONTRACT NO. 6618
This letter will serve as an agreement between Habitat Restoration Sciences, Inc., a California corporation
(Contractor) and the City of Carlsbad (City). The Contractor will provide all equipment, material and labor
necessary to use hand tools to remove a tree in Sunnycreek in a City drainage easement on Coman
property, per the Contractor's proposal dated April 2, 2015 and City specifications, for a sum not to exceed
two thousand two hundred fifty dollars ($2,250). This work is to be completed within thirty (30) working days
after issuance of a Purchase Order.

Scope of Work
Tree Removal
This proposal covers the cost for labor and equipment to remove the downed (1) large oak tree at
the Coleman Property. The trunk will be cut into 12" to 14" pieces that will be left on-site for the
property owner. HRS will haul out the other small branches and loose debris from the creek and
surrounding area.
Nesting Bird Survey
HRS will perform a focused survey for active bird nests to determine if any bird nests are present
within the project site. The survey will be performed by a qualified biologist within forty-eight
(48) hours prior to work in the area. The resuh of the survey shall be kept on record in the form
of a written report. If the survey identified an active nest, a buffer shall be established between
the construction activities and the active nest so that nesting activities are not interrupted. The
buffer shall be delineated by temporary flagging, and shall be in effect throughout construction
or until the nest is no longer active. The buffer size will be dependent on the species of bird
encountered.
